Who is Caroline Schwitzky?

Caroline Schwitzky is the CEO of CS Talent ENT, a Miami-based talent agency that she founded in 2011. Before founding her talent agency, Schwitzky attended Miami Dade College, where she studied television production and marketing. Outside of the office, Schwitzky is an actress with recent credits in Christmas in Miami and After Hours.

Who is Caroline Schwitzky’s husband?

Schwitzky is married to Jonathan LeBron, whom she met at a restaurant in Miami. The two appeared on Divorce Court in 2024 during Season 26. At the time, Schwitzky and LeBron were engaged, but she suspected he had been cheating. Schwitzky entered their relationship with four kids and recently welcomed a baby with LeBron in 2026.

When did Caroline Schwitzky appear on 90 Day Fiancé?

Schwitzky briefly appeared on 90 Day Fiancé: Happily Ever After? as the talent agent of series regular Paola Mayfield. She can be seen in episodes from both Season 1 and Season 2. Fans will remember that it was Schwitzky who convinced Paola and her husband, Russ Mayfield, to move from Oklahoma to Florida to kick-start her modeling career.

What happened between Caroline Schwitzky and Cole Goldberg?

On April 24, 2022, Schwitzky and her then-boyfriend Cole Goldberg attended an annual Florida boat party called the “Boca Bash,” after roughly a year of dating. Goldberg was later charged with attempted murder and domestic battery for allegedly holding Schwitzky underwater at the party. The Palm Beach Post reported that witnesses in nearby boats claimed Goldberg held Schwitzky by the throat “in a complete rage” until someone intervened.

Goldberg’s lawyers have denied the accusations, saying that the judgment of the witness was “impaired by alcohol but taken seriously by responding officers who had never worked a domestic-violence case before.” Prosecutors offered Goldberg a plea agreement that included six months in jail, three years of probation, and a 500-word apology letter. He turned down the offer in favor of a bench trial.

What was the verdict on the Cole Goldberg trial?

According to TMZ, Goldberg was found not guilty of attempted murder after three days in court. The outlet reported that the judge said there was “too much inconsistency in witness testimony … and enough reasonable doubt to acquit Goldberg.”

Goldberg told the outlet, “I’m so glad the truth finally came out. I’ve been dealing with this since 2022, so it feels like a weight has been lifted off my shoulder. There’s no resentment with Caroline, I just can’t believe she would ever think I could do something like that.” His lawyers continued, “We are all relieved and grateful that this four-year ordeal is over. We had every confidence in Judge Parnofiello’s ability to be fair to both sides of the aisle and to follow the law. Despite being a young judge, his sense of fairness, intelligence, and reputation for following the law is undisputed.”

What has Caroline Schwitzky said about the outcome?

In an interview with TMZ on April 15, Schwitzky told those following the trial, “I feel very bad about the system itself, the judge. I can’t believe that the judge, even with all those witnesses, he just allowed this kid to walk freely. It blows my mind, but it goes to show you that in this world, it’s not what you say, it’s what you can prove.” Going forward, Schwitzky has vowed to be an advocate for women facing domestic violence.
